Transaction 01240afca6967fdb08ab89bd510d1cb19abae6a24f8d51a08d8a2d8ad3fb18e3

1 Input
2 Outputs
  • 01240afca6967fdb08ab89bd510d1cb19abae6a24f8d51a08d8a2d8ad3fb18e3:0
  • value  293123828
    address  1DXL1qou5WLP8JCEJhYyQKiW54fg6zYkmy
  • 01240afca6967fdb08ab89bd510d1cb19abae6a24f8d51a08d8a2d8ad3fb18e3:1
  • value  1515779269
    address  3KrrsAtvMyQWRf6YAe7vfsPHBUYDcFnH4J